Step 1: Damage Assessment
We’ll inspect your condo to identify the source and extent of the damage. Our team will use specialized equipment to detect hidden moisture and assess the level of damage. This step is crucial in determining the best course of action for restoration.
Step 2: Water Removal
Our team will use truck-mounted extraction equipment to remove standing water from your condo. We’ll also use wet vacuums and other specialized tools to extract water from carpets, upholstery, and other materials.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use industrial-grade dehumidifiers and air movers to speed up the drying process and prevent further damage. Our technicians will also monitor moisture levels to ensure the affected areas are completely dry.
Step 4: Repair and Replacement
Once the drying process is complete, our team will repair or replace any damaged materials, including drywall, carpet, and flooring.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Unpleasant odors can be a sign of hidden moisture and mold growth. If you notice a persistent musty smell in your condo, don’t hesitate to call us. We’ll inspect your condo and provide a solution to remove the odor and prevent further damage.
Water Stains on Walls or Ceiling
Water stains can be a sign of a leaky pipe or roof damage. If you notice water stains on your walls or ceiling, call us immediately to prevent further damage and costly repairs.
Floors That Feel Spongy or Soft
Spongy or soft floors can be a sign of water damage or a structural issue. Our team will inspect your condo and provide a solution to repair or replace the affected materials.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of moisture damage or a structural issue. Our team will inspect your condo and provide a solution to repair or replace the affected materials.
Water-Damaged Drywall or Ceiling Tiles
Water-damaged drywall or ceiling tiles can be a sign of a leaky pipe or roof damage. Our team will inspect your condo and provide a solution to repair or replace the affected materials.
